    Can a trooper in HD declare cautious movement, if his hidden location is inside the enemys LoF or ZoC? (The end if the movement is outside)

    I think yes, because at the declaration of the order he is tecnecaly outside the LoF or Zoc, because he 'is considered not on the table'
    On the other hand, HD says:'when declaring an order...place a Camo marker at the location of HD

    No, you can’t. As you say, the marker is placed on the table when declaring the Order.

    The OP is talking about the Active Trooper starting in Hidden Deployment.
